What does a legal assistant scheduler do?

A Legal Assistant Scheduler is responsible for coordinating and managing the schedules of attorneys, clients, witnesses, and court dates within a law firm or legal department. Their duties include setting appointments, managing calendars, confirming deadlines, and ensuring all parties are informed of any changes. They play a crucial role in maintaining organization and efficiency in legal proceedings by preventing scheduling conflicts and keeping everyone on track. In addition, they often communicate with courts and other law firms to arrange meetings and hearings. Attention to detail and strong communication skills are essential for this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a legal assistant scheduler?

A Legal Assistant Scheduler requires str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and a background in legal administrative support, often with an associate's degree or relevant experience. Familiarity with legal calendaring software, Microsoft Office Suite, and case management systems is typically necessary. Excellent communication, time management, and the ability to prioritize tasks under pressure are standout soft skills in this role. These competencies are crucial for ensuring accurate scheduling, supporting legal teams effectively, and maintaining compliance with critical court deadlines.

What are some common challenges legal assistant schedulers face and how can they effectively manage shifting priorities?

Legal Assistant Schedulers often encounter rapidly changing priorities, such as last-minute court date changes or urgent attorney requests. Staying organized with digital calendars, maintaining clear communication with attorneys and clients, and developing strong multitasking skills are key to managing these challenges. Proactively confirming appointments and anticipating scheduling conflicts can also help minimize disruptions. Adapting to evolving needs and remaining flexible are essential traits for success in this role.

Job Description

Job description:

The Legal Scheduling Coordinator is a member of the Workers Compensation Legal team and is responsible for supporting the attorneys by coordinating and managing their schedules. This individual must be detailed-oriented, have great time management, and organizational skills.

Job responsibilities:

  • Set hearings, depositions, mediations and phone conferences.
  • Heavy telephone use and calendaring of appointments.
  • Handle the scheduling of all depositions and client meetings.
  • Secure videographer and interpreters when needed.
  • Have knowledge of the court system, including but not limited to, electronic filing (e-filing) and electronic e-service.
  • Proficiency in MS Word and Outlook.
  • Knowledge of Workers Compensation is preferred.
